Transaction 8e486e644ade704304394c805f29f85811b274e818870678336ca2b923337c6a
1 Input
1 Output
-
8e486e644ade704304394c805f29f85811b274e818870678336ca2b923337c6a:0
- value
- 15074974
- script pubkey
- OP_0 OP_PUSHBYTES_20 5dc94188f1dbf42b94b32e16179d64e51cc44477
- address
- bc1qthy5rz83m06zh99n9ctp08tyu5wvg3rhmqed8u